You have two possibilities:
- Use the SES AWS API for sending. Either with the SDK client in the language of your app or using the AWS CLI
aws ses send-email
- just configure your EC2 instance to relay mails to SES and send the mails to localhost via
relayhost
in postfix for example
relayhost = [email-smtp.us-west-1.amazonaws.com]:587
There's good documentation on this at https://docs.aws.amazon.com/ses/latest/dg/postfix.html
